Valentine’s Day is coming up, and one of Central New York’s most unique celebrations is back.
Highland Forest is hosting its popular “Valentine’s in the Forest” event, and tickets are officially on sale. This is more than just a dinner out, it’s a full evening of romance, fun, and a little bit of winter magic, all while supporting a great cause.
Event Details and Dates
The event takes place Friday and Saturday, February 13th and 14th, 2026, from 6 to 9 p.m. Tickets are $100 per person, and space is extremely limited, with only 100 seats available each night….. so planning ahead is key if you want to join in. Every dollar from the evening benefits Highland Forest’s all-volunteer Nordic Ski Patrol, helping support those who keep the park safe and welcoming all winter long.
Gourmet Dining and Entertainment
Guests will be greeted with a welcome prosecco cocktail before diving into a four-course buffet dinner catered by CopperTop Catering, the menu is designed to impress, whether you’re celebrating with a sweetheart, a friend, or even a small group. After dinner, a DJ will set the mood for dancing, while a photo booth captures memories from the night. A cash-only bar will also be available for those looking to enjoy a little extra spirit with the evening.
Horse-Drawn Sleigh Ride Through Luminary Forest
One of the highlights of the night is a horse-drawn sleigh ride through the forest, which is fully decorated with luminary lights.
